Individuals being drugged & robbed while utilizing escort services throughout Surrey

Surrey RCMP is cautioning members of the public following several instances involving individuals being drugged and robbed while utilizing escort services throughout the region. 

Police have become aware of several instances of individuals hiring an escort online, meeting at pre-arranged locations across the Lower Mainland, being drugged and waking up to find their valuables stolen. 

These occurrences are concerning as they pose a high risk to the health and safety of the individuals being drugged with unknown substances.  If you have been drugged, it is highly recommended that you seek medical assistance immediately.

Any encounters that involve meeting up with unknown individuals that take place behind closed doors, brings about inherent risk to all parties involved. If you choose to meet with unknown individuals, it is recommended to take precautions, including:

  • Maintain continuity of all food or beverages you consume to ensure that they have not been spiked.
  • Do not consume anything provided to you by the other person.
  • Do not use drugs or alcohol that can impair your ability to keep yourself safe.
  • Let a trusted person know where you are who can contact police should you not check in with them by a specified time.

Police believe that there are likely additional victims who are reluctant to make a police report.

Surrey RCMP is encouraging anyone who has been a victim of a similar incident to contact their police of jurisdiction and make a police report.
